Subject: DR drill results — waveform preview service

Team, Thursday's drill restored the Fernpitch waveform preview service in 22 minutes, within target. Cache warm-up was the slow step; Odalys is scripting it. One gap: the restored render node couldn't unseal its config vault automatically. For the sync, note that manual unseal requires the recovery passphrase below.

vault phrase of bagaf-kajeg = jorath-feniel-briir-siliel-ralix

Handover: Petrov to Imani, for eng sync. Report builder (Slatewing) sorting is not stable — equal keys reorder between runs because the comparator falls back to pointer order. Fix in progress on branch sort-stable-ties: switch to mergesort and add row-index tiebreak. Tests half done. One blocker: the fixtures archive is sealed and I'm out Friday. To unseal it, use the recovery passphrase written just under this note.

unlock words, yagag-yahog: gordor-zorvan-druius-queniel-normir-norwyn-framir-novmir-ralius-holwyn-wenwyn-tamael-silok-holdor

Ticket: Harrowgate catalogue import failing since Monday. Root cause: the credential used by the Shelfward importer against the internal records service expired and the nightly job silently retried for three days. We've added expiry alerting and re-run the backlog. A fresh credential was issued this morning and is pasted below.

API key for yahig-tadup: kto7_ubizbYm